Accompanied by Amrutha Murali - violin and karrakurichi mOhanrAm - mrudangam
concert time was from 1:45 to 3:45 pm dot time
1A viruththam "vakrathunta mahAkAya" - pantuvarAli -??
1B. Sami ninne nammina - pantuvarAli - shatkarla narasayyA
2A. rAga alApanai of bahudAri
2B. viruththam in brief "arutjyOthi ... sadAnanda deivam..." - bahudAri -???
2C. sadAnanda tANDavam(R N S) - bahudAri - achuthadAsar
neraval in "muttarum siddharum munivargaLum mOna mAdhavarum mAmUvargaLum"
3. bhooshAvathim(R) - bhooshAvati (vAcaspathi) - MD
4. paramapurusha jagadeeshwara(S) - vasantA - ST
5A. rAmA neeyeDa (R N S T)- kharaharapriya - T
neraval in " tana saukhyamu tAnErugaka "
11 minutes of alApanai, 5 minutes of violin return, 6 minutes of krithi rendition, 7 minutes of neraval and 12 minutes of swaras
5B. tani
6. dual rAga RTP "sAranganai ranganai ninai (in SAranga ) manamE dhinamE brindAvana (brindAvana sAranga)"
8 minutes of rAgam in both with brief violin return, 5 minutes of tAnam,4 minutes of pallavi with 6 minutes of swaras.
7A. viruththam "petra thAi " - sindhubhairavi + mOhanam - rAmalinga swamigal
7B. dArisanam kandArkku marujanmam illaiyE thillai - mOhanam - ???
Quick review ,stareted with just a good pantuvarAli varnam that is bit rare.The highlight to me was bahudAri , particularly neraval in sadAnanda tAndavam , I have not heard from any musicians, in total the entire bahudAri was outstanding.(Has any musician sung a neraval in sadananda tAndavam, please do post the musicians name)
The vAchaspathi (bhooshAvati)of MD was perhaps intended to connect the academy connoisseur, I found it not too interesting.That was offset with very good swaras in vasantA after he sang a rare krithi.The swaras and alApanai of kharaharapriya main was excellent, but the neraval was just good to very good .
Dual RTP had its pluses and minuses of a 2hr concert , Plus was perhaps a demonstration of vidwath but the minus to me was very personal he sang longer swarams for sArangA , but shortened in one of my favourite rAgas brindAvana sAranga, would have loved if it was reverse. both the tAnam and rAga alApanai though brief was very good to excellent.
Smt Amritha played very good , there was a slight slip where she had to retune during RTP, but suryaprakAsh continued well . Her rAga return of bahudAri ,sAranga and brindavAna sAranga was excellent in melody.The mridangist was just good. The last mOhanam was very good in diction and I was hearing it for the first time.
Overall a very good concert, there is a consistency of delivery in suryaprakAsh that impresses me a lot .But I had little higher expectation here in academy .
